Possuo um sistema de delivery de comida, como o Ifood (eat24, Ubereat) ele é desenvolvido em Magento 1 e cada restaurante gerencia seu estabelecimento e seus produtos, usamos para isso o módulo de marketplace da CED Commerce [login to view URL]
O Estabelecimento possui um painel de controle onde ele pode gerenciar seus pedidos (criar ordem, criar entrega) porém como é um sistema de delivery de comida é preciso que o estabelecimento receba em tempo real o novo pedido para que possa enviar com máxima rapidez, precisamos das seguintes alterações.
1 - Criar um sistema de push notificação, para que todo novo pedido seja notificado em tempo real no navegador do restaurante, se possível que ele seja obrigado a ativar a notificação ou que seja exibido uma mensagem, “é necessário permitir as notificações”.
2 - Se o restaurante estiver online no painel dele, seja exibido no frontend (na página dos seus produtos) o texto DISPONÍVEL PARA ENTREGA e caso deslogar (ou fechar o navegador) o sistema altere para INDISPONÍVEL, assim como o [login to view URL] ou o chat online da zopim.
3 - Por último, caso ele esteja com a página de pedido aberta, que seja atualizada assim que o pedido chegar (para que a nova ordem seja exibida), sempre que o push for enviado ou talvez via Ajax, pensamos em manter um reload periódico mas isso pode sobrecarregar o servidor.
Essas foram nossas ideias, caso tenha uma solução mais simples estamos abertos a propostas.
Caro cliente,
Saudações!!
Eu sou Magento / WordPress desenvolvedor tendo mais de 7 anos de experiência em design e tema personalizado e desenvolvimento de módulos personalizados, trabalhando em ambas as versões 1. x para 2. x. Todos os tipos de solução Magento podem fornecer e eu li as exigências de trabalho com cuidado, por favor, compartilhe mais detalhes do projeto, nós faremos este trabalho a tempo.
Habilidades: Magento / WordPress / Comércio Eletrônico / Design Gráfico / HTML / PHP / Design de Sites etc.
Estou ansioso para continuar a discutir. !!
Por favor, não hesite em contactar-me se você tiver alguma dúvida.
Mais discussão sobre o chat
obrigado
Hitesh